免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

ios应用程序签名失败

在iOS开发中,应用程序签名是一个非常重要的步骤,它确保了应用的安全性和完整性。应用签名是通过将应用程序与一个数字证书绑定来完成的,这个证书是由苹果颁发的,用于验证应用程序的来源和完整性。

应用签名的失败可能会导致应用无法在iOS设备上安装或者无法运行。有很多原因可能会导致签名失败,下面我将详细介绍一些常见的原因和解决方案。

1. 证书过期或无效:苹果颁发的证书通常有一个有效期,如果你的证书已经过期或被撤销,那么签名将失败。解决方案是到苹果开发者网站重新申请一个有效的证书,并将其导入到你的开发环境中。

2. Provisioning Profile不匹配:Provisioning Profile是用于配置你的应用程序与设备进行通信的文件。如果你的Provisioning Profile与你正在使用的证书不匹配,那么签名将失败。解决方案是检查你的Provisioning Profile设置,并确保它与你的证书相匹配。

3. 证书配置错误:有时候,你可能会在配置文件的过程中出错,比如错误地选择了错误的证书类型或使用了无效的证书文件。解决方案是仔细检查你的证书配置,并确保它的正确性。

4. Xcode版本不兼容:如果你的Xcode版本太旧或太新,可能会导致与签名相关的问题。解决方案是确保你的Xcode版本与你正在使用的证书和配置文件相兼容。

5. 第三方工具错误:有些开发者可能会使用第三方工具来处理应用签名,如果这些工具存在错误或配置问题,那么签名将失败。解决方案是使用官方支持的工具来进行签名,并确保工具的配置正确。

总的来说,签名失败可能是由于证书过期、Provisioning Profile不匹配、证书配置错误、Xcode版本不兼容或第三方工具错误等原因导致。解决签名失败的问题需要仔细检查和调试,确保证书、配置文件和工具的正确性和一致性。如果遇到问题,可以参考苹果官方文档或咨询相关领域的专家和开发者进行帮助和支持。


相关知识:
appstore怎么上传应用
AppStore怎么上传应用?详细步骤指南 在移动应用开发的世界里,将应用成功上传至AppStore是每个开发者的终极目标之一。然而,对于新手开发者来说,这个过程可能会显得有些复杂和令人困惑。本文将为你提供一份详细的指南,帮助你了解如何将应用上传至AppS
2025-05-06
苹果ipa签名是什么东西
苹果的ipa签名是指在iOS设备上安装和运行应用程序时,将应用程序的身份验证和安全验证信息包含在应用程序文件中的过程。它确保应用程序是由可信的开发者创建,并且在传输和安装过程中未被更改。ipa签名的原理是使用公钥密码学和数字证书来验证应用程序的身份。当开发
2023-07-18
安卓应用签名证书生成工具
安卓应用签名证书生成工具是开发者在发布应用程序时所必须的一项工作。签名证书用于验证应用程序的身份和完整性,确保应用程序没有被篡改或恶意修改。本文将详细介绍签名证书的原理和生成工具的使用。一、签名证书的原理在安卓系统中,每个应用程序都必须使用一个唯一的数字签
2023-07-17
apk签名工具安卓美化版
APK签名工具是一种用于给Android应用打包的APK文件进行数字签名的工具。签名是为了验证应用的真实性和完整性,确保应用在传输和安装过程中不被篡改。一般来说,APK签名是由应用开发者来进行的,签名过程需要使用开发者的数字证书来创建一个数字签名。数字证书
2023-07-17
阿里云 android自签名
阿里云(Alibaba Cloud)是国内领先的云计算服务提供商,提供了丰富的产品和服务。Android自签名是在开发Android应用时进行数字证书签名的过程,可以保证应用的安全性和完整性。本文将详细介绍阿里云Android自签名的原理和步骤。Andro
2023-07-17
apk签名提取软件
APK签名提取软件是一种用于提取Android应用程序包(APK)中签名信息的工具。在Android应用程序开发和分发过程中,签名是验证应用程序来源和完整性的重要组成部分。APK签名提取软件可以帮助开发人员和安全人员验证APK文件的签名,并进行进一步的分析
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4